Hi! I'm Marcie. I am a Licensed Clinical Social Worker with over 15 years of experience helping individuals work toward becoming their best self.  I provide a space in which you feel comfortable and safe sharing your journey and challenges. I strive to create a therapeutic space that is non-judgemental, grounded in empathy, and help bring light to your individual strengths, your value and self-worth. I believe everyone is capable of change and positive personal growth.


Life is challenging and it's important to know you are not alone. Whether it's struggling to find balance between work and home, overwhelming stress and anxiety, or facing the ever dreaded "Sunday scaries" at the end of each week; no issue is too small or inconsequential. My specialty areas include treating individuals with anxiety, depression, life transitions and relationship problems, and offering support and guidance to parents of children diagnosed with mental health issues. I utilize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Mindfulness, and Solution Focused Therapy as my primary methods of treatment. I am Gabrielle Robles, LCSW, a bilingual therapist (English/Spanish) with nearly 20 years of experience supporting adults in furthering resilience and healing. My clinical journey began in community mental health, where I witnessed the power of human connection and the importance of honoring each person’s story. I bring expertise in client advocacy, case management, and multidisciplinary collaboration.

I practice from a client-centered, trauma-informed, and culturally sensitive lens. My work integrates multiple evidence-based modalities,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T), Motivational Interviewing, and Narrative Therapy. I have a particular interest in how transnational identities and intergenerational trauma shape lives and relationships. I also believe humor can be a meaningful part of the healing process. Sometimes laughter opens doors that words alone cannot.

If you are feeling weighed down by stress, anxiety, depression, trauma, or a difficult life transition, you don’t have to carry that story alone.

In our work together, you will find a safe and supportive space to explore your experiences, strengthen coping skills, and open new pathways toward growth, balance, and lasting change.

 I believe it is a priority as a therapist to recognize the day-to-day differences in each person's experience and adjust to match those needs in sessions. I strive to engage clients in sincere conversations about their thoughts, emotions and experiences to build insight, provide coping skills, and move toward positive change. I focus on bringing a human connection to our discussions, providing a comforting environment and authentic interaction. I enjoy the opportunity at times to bring humor and levity to sessions, while also recognizing the deep vulnerability my clients share as we engage in therapy. 

 

As a trauma-informed and EMDR trained therapist I am prepared to help reprocess and cope with trauma history. Further, my experience as a CASAC-G provides me the skills and knowledge to work with clients with impulse management disorders, such as substance abuse and gambling issues.
